PROFILE

Baby Ace began spinning music and toying with remix ideas in 1987 while still in high school. Immediately after graduating he started spinning at the 2 top clubs in his hometown - Mandeville, Jamaica. Within 6 months he was offered a DJ position at one of the newest hotels in the island on the North Coast, which catered directly to the tourists visiting the island. Baby Ace became the resident DJ at the hotel as well as spinning at 3 different clubs on the weekends. Not to mention being a guest DJ at one of the islands newest radio stations. After about a year, he migrated to the US to further his education in Electronics Engineering Technology. Having moved to Atlanta, Georgia, Baby Ace soon became one of the top club DJs in the city. Over a period of 10 years he was the resident DJ at 3 different clubs, (always kept them packed) and also became an alternate weekend guest DJ for WCLK 91.9FM. In 1999 he was awarded the people's choice award for the Best Solo DJ in Atlanta, and in the same year he was offered the opportunity to help open a recording studio where he was the recording and mixing engineer. While still holding things down at the Footprints Nightclub, (every Friday & Saturday night for about 5 years straight) he began working part-time at WAEC 860AM as a shift engineer/announcer. He soon became more involved in radio by hosting 2 "Reggae" based radio shows on the AM airwaves.

Still in search of his golden opportunity, Baby Ace moved to California, close to the Bay Area where with the help of an enthusiastic friend, he landed a residential DJ spot at the Island Paradise Club. Pursuing other opportunities that were lead by other responsibilities, Baby Ace moved to the LA area in California (where he is now based). Hanging on to his love for broadcasting, and boasting the talent to move people musically, he started his own Internet Radio Station on June 9th 2002 on live365. His Internet Radio Station has rapidly grown to a favorite among many and now boasts that over 9000 listeners worldwide have "Baby Ace Radio" locked into their internet radio presets. Throughout his career, Baby Ace mastered the art of remixing which has always set his musical presentation aside from all other DJs, and his "personal exclusive remixes" have no doubt helped him to become a favorite DJ to hundreds of thousands, and possibly millions of Reggae/Hip Hop lovers all over the world. Baby Ace is no stranger to the Dancehall Reggae scene having played alongside some of the biggest and best in the business. Such as : Stone Love, Bass Odyssey, Bodyguard, Metromedia, Waggy T, Ranaissance, Poison Dart, Mellosound, Super Gold, Delta Force & Venus (namely "Cancer" formerly of Stone Love). He has also played on shows featuring artists like : Shaggy, Rayvon, Brian & Tony Gold, Beres Hammond, Buju Banton, Merciless, Leroy Gibbons, (former) Born Jamericans, & Louie Rankin. Baby Ace has even done studio production with the likes of Horace Andy, Scion Success, Don Yute and Monty Montgomery. Since moving to California, Baby Ace worked with Johncrow Entertainment, to back performances of artists like, Spragga Benz, Assasin, and Mr Easy. Most recently, he played a very instrumental part in the production of the Killah Pride - Predatah Squad Vol 1 Mixed CD, which gave him an opportunity to work with the talent of KRS-ONE, Shinehead, Mad Lion, Edley Shine(from Born Jamericans) and Nickey Fungus.
